Brief Summary

This study will be designed as a randomized clinical trial of 12-month duration. A total of 40 patients will be recruited and randomly equally distributed into 4 groups: an experimental group treated with SRP + LC, a first control group treated with SRP + L, a second control group treated with SRP+D and a third control group SRP alone.
Each defect will be treated with an ultrasonic scaler with dedicated thin tips for supra- and subgingival debridement associated with hand instrumentation under local anesthesia. Caution will be taken to preserve the stability of soft tissues. Following SRP, experimental and control sites will be randomly chosen. The test sites will be t filled with a Lipo-Curcumin gel and sealed with cyanoacrylate. In the first control group the defects will be be filled with a Lipo gel and sealed with cyanoacrylate. In the second control sites he pocket defect will be filled with a discharged gel and sealed with cyanoacrylate, in the third control group SRP alone will be performed.
Pre- and post-treatment clinical measurements were performed by an examiner blinded to the treatment modalities using a graded periodontal probe (HuFriedy UNC 15). Before the treatment and at 6 and 12 months post-treatment, all patients were examined by measuring the clinical attachment level, probing depth, gingival recession, full-mouth plaque score and bleeding on probing.

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
Lipo-Curcumin gel + SRP
After SRP the pocket defect will be filled with a Lipo-Curcumin gel and sealed with cyanoacrylate.
Lipo-Curcumin gel + SRP
The pocket defect will be debrided with the use of fine ultrasonic tips and mini hand instruments and will be treated with the application of Lipo- Curcumin gel. The pocket will be sealed with cyanoacrylate.
Lipo gel + SRP
After SRP the pocket defect will be filled with a Lipo gel and sealed with cyanoacrylate
Lipo gel + SRP
The pocket defect will be debrided with the use of fine ultrasonic tips and mini hand instruments and will be treated with the application of Lipo gel. The pocket will be sealed with cyanoacrylate.
Discharged Gel + SRP
After SRP the pocket defect will be filled with a discharged gel and sealed with cyanoacrylate
Discharged Gel + SRP
The pocket defect will be debrided with the use of fine ultrasonic tips and mini hand instruments and will be treated with the application of discharged gel. The pocket will be sealed with cyanoacrylate.
SRP alone
SRP alone will be performed.
SRP alone
The pocket defect will only be debrided with the use of fine ultrasound tips and mini hand instruments and no further treatment will be performed.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* on-smokers or former smokers who quit at least 1 year ago, and had not received any periodontal treatment in the 3 months prior to recruitment
* FMPS \< 20% at baseline
* Furcation not involved
* Not Pregnant or Lactating
* Signed informed consent
Exclusion Criteria
* Patients that had received systemic or local delivery of antibiotic therapy 6 weeks before enrollment
* Chronic intake of NSAIDs or steroids, currently
